Output 3e0ba425a7884d74ab9c67fbf340a021ed270c563bb3a79cc9e76ee20737bef8:0

value
21890816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5dac9562b089d1afa2a252c2180eced2046863e OP_EQUAL
address
3NeNm2K5KpanCogsoyDhwjt69bwK3XkxnH
transaction
3e0ba425a7884d74ab9c67fbf340a021ed270c563bb3a79cc9e76ee20737bef8
spent
true